Abstract:
This application relates to a lighting system comprising a plurality of light emitting diode, LED, circuits, and a power source for providing a drive voltage to the plurality of LED circuits. For each LED circuit, the lighting system comprises a first variable resistance element connected between the respective LED circuit and ground, and a first feedback circuit configured to control a voltage at a first node between the respective LED circuit and the respective first variable resistance element to a first voltage. The lighting system further comprises a current source and a second variable resistance element connected between the current source and ground, wherein each first variable resistance element is configured to attain a resistance value depending on a resistance value attained by the second variable resistance element.
